Beef Bucks Adds Debit Cards
South Dakota Beef Bucks supporters can now give the gift of beef on a VISA debit card. Accepted anywhere VISA is accepted, the first-of-its-kind debit card can be loaded for $25 to $500 in value for the purchase of beef at any retail outlet, be it grocery stores, restaurants or home-delivery services.
The cards can be loaded anywhere, and reloaded up to the expiration date. The acquisition fee for the BEEF BUCK/VISA card is $4, plus the face value of the card. The cost includes a gift card with an area for your message, and an envelope.
Bob Montross, DeSmet, SD, says the new debit-card program took almost nine months to set up and implement. He adds that the South Dakota Beef Bucks program will continue to offer Beef Bucks' pre-paid checks, which are available in $5, $10 and $20 denominations.
